This 19th-century Italian Grand Tour hand-carved marble head of a man—sourced from a private collection in Lexington, Tennessee—is an exceptional study in classical form and material contrast. Sculpted in the ancient Roman style, the piece captures a refined, idealized countenance defined by soft facial contours, a serene expression, and the linear, rhythmic hair carvings characteristic of classical antiquity. Over time, the marble has developed a rich, nuanced patina, transforming the stone's surface with warm tonal variations that heighten its sculptural depth and tactile quality. In a striking design-forward juxtaposition, the fluid, organic lines of the ancient fragment are elevated by a stark, geometric ebonized black wooden block. The base, secured with a central metal mounting rod, exhibits authentic, subtle wear and character distressing along its edges, grounding the luminous, historical marble with an element of structural minimalism that speaks directly to a sophisticated contemporary aesthetic.
